No Bonmati, no problem - Spain put down major Euros marker
Published on Friday, 4 July 2025 at 11:31 am

The whispers had grown louder in recent weeks, a growing murmur among pundits and fans alike. Could Spain truly conquer Euro 2025 without their reigning Ballon d'Or winner, Aitana Bonmatí? The midfield maestro, a lynchpin of their recent successes, was a glaring omission from the squad, leading many to question the defending champions' vulnerability. Yet, any lingering doubts about La Roja’s potency were not just dispelled, but utterly obliterated, a mere 87 seconds into their tournament opener against Portugal.
From the very first whistle, Spain played with a ferocious intensity that belied any pre-match anxieties. They swarmed the Portuguese midfield, pressing high and moving the ball with a familiar, almost telepathic fluidity. The opening goal, a clinical finish born from a rapid transition and exquisite link-up play, served as a thunderclap warning to the rest of Europe. It wasn't just the speed of the goal, but the collective effort behind it that truly resonated. It was a statement: this Spanish side is not defined by one individual, but by a deep well of talent and an unwavering commitment to their intricate, possession-based philosophy. The early strike set the tone for a performance that was as dominant as it was emphatic, showcasing a team that has clearly adapted and thrived in the face of adversity.
Portugal, for all their resilience, found themselves chasing shadows for much of the encounter. Spain controlled the tempo, dictated the spaces, and demonstrated a tactical maturity that suggested they are not merely relying on past glories but are evolving. Substitutions were seamless, maintaining the high press and relentless attacking waves, proving the depth of their bench. The defensive unit, often overshadowed by the attacking flair, was equally impressive, snuffing out any nascent Portuguese threats with disciplined positioning and sharp interceptions. This comprehensive display, both offensively and defensively, underscored their credentials as tournament frontrunners.
This commanding victory against a capable Portuguese side sends an unequivocal message across the continent. Spain’s Euro 2025 campaign has begun not with a tentative step, but with a powerful stride, asserting their dominance and silencing the skeptics. They proved that their strength lies in their system, their collective understanding, and the sheer quality distributed across the pitch. While Bonmatí’s absence might have created a void, it appears to have galvanized a team determined to prove its collective might. The journey for the European crown has just begun, but Spain has already laid down a formidable marker, indicating they are very much the team to beat.
